Our Community Fridge - Monkton Heathfield

Taunton, UK

We are a locally volunteer run Community Fridge - we reduce waste by collecting food from local shops and putting them in the fridge daily for the residents to collect and use.

Rethink Mental Illness Taunton

Taunton, UK

To provide information, advice, support & services of the highest standard to those experiencing severe mental illness, their families & carers, in areas such as housing, education & training, rehabilitation & employment and recreation. to spread understanding about severe mental illness. to campaign nationally & locally for high quality care, including both acute & long-term services. In Somerset we provide supported accommodation to individuals with varying degree of mental health issues. People that use are service tend to come to us having previously been homeless and are not set up on the benefits system correctly so have no income. We provide support to better peoples skills so they are better prepared for living independently in the future. We would benefit from donations that would contribute towards our planned cooking groups where we teach our tenants to live healthier lifestyles on a budget.

YMCA Taunton

Taunton, UK

YMCA Taunton is part of the largest and oldest charity working with young people in the world. We want to: Invest in young people to help them reach their full potential, by providing for all ages including Youth Services, Ofsted approved pre-school education, sport and other activity. Strengthen families; be at the heart of the local community, supporting the whole community; providing a safe supportive environment for all. Encourage health and wellbeing for all, through activity and sport. Respond effectively to the needs of the most vulnerable children, young people and families; through youth activities, advice and guidance. Work closely with parents and partner organisations. Fulfil our Christian mission by bringing peace, justice and hope to broken lives. To create supportive, inclusive and energising communities where young people belong. We have currently been working with our young people on a fruitful communities project to start with our outdoor area. We aim to have a tidy space that the young people can have a sense of pride, belonging and take ownership of their achievements. To designate their area and improve health and safety we would like to add a small perimeter fence. This project will give the young people involved opportunity of learning many new skills including construction, landscaping, creativity, risk assessing and working as part of a team. We continue to work with the young people on the importance of maintaining the area.
